How they compare
Serbia currently reports 93.1% against 92.6% in Ghana, a difference of 0.5%.
Across all 10 years both countries report, Serbia has been ahead every year.
Ghana ranks 83rd and Serbia ranks 80th of 161 countries.
Serbia has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Ghana | Serbia |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 79.2% | 98.9% | 19.6% | Serbia |
| 2010s | 83.1% | 98.6% | 15.6% | Serbia |
| 2020s | 91.0% | 96.4% | 5.4% | Serbia |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
